问小白 wenxiaobai
资讯
历史
科技
环境与自然
成长
游戏
财经
文学与艺术
美食
健康
家居
文化
情感
汽车
三农
军事
旅行
运动
教育
生活
星座命理

Excel中保留尾数的多种方法详解

创作时间:
作者:
@小白创作中心

Excel中保留尾数的多种方法详解

引用
1
来源
1.
https://docs.pingcode.com/baike/4707754

在Excel中保留尾数的几种方法包括:使用函数、格式设置、四舍五入。其中,使用函数是最灵活和广泛应用的方法。通过使用Excel函数,例如ROUND、TRUNC、MOD等,可以精确地控制数字尾数的保留方式。本文将详细介绍这些方法及其应用场景。

一、使用函数保留尾数

使用Excel函数是保留尾数的最常用方法。这些函数包括ROUND、TRUNC、MOD等。每个函数有不同的用途和适用场景。

1. ROUND函数

ROUND函数用于将数字四舍五入到指定的位数。

例子:

假设在A1单元格中有一个数字123.4567,你希望将其保留两位小数,可以在B1单元格中输入以下公式:

  
=ROUND(A1, 2)
  

结果将是123.46。

2. TRUNC函数

TRUNC函数用于将数字截断到指定的小数位数,而不会进行四舍五入。

例子:

如果你希望将A1单元格中的数字123.4567截断到两位小数,可以在B1单元格中输入以下公式:

  
=TRUNC(A1, 2)
  

结果将是123.45。

3. MOD函数

MOD函数用于返回两个数字相除的余数。可以用于保留特定小数位数或整数位数。

例子:

如果你希望保留数字123.4567的小数部分,可以在B1单元格中输入以下公式:

  
=MOD(A1, 1)
  

结果将是0.4567。

二、格式设置保留尾数

格式设置是另一种保留尾数的方法,通过设置单元格格式,可以控制显示的数字位数。

1. 使用“单元格格式”对话框

右键点击需要设置的单元格,选择“设置单元格格式”,在“数字”选项卡中选择“数字”类别,然后设置小数位数。

例子:

假设你希望将A1单元格中的数字123.4567保留两位小数:

  1. 右键点击A1单元格。

  2. 选择“设置单元格格式”。

  3. 在“数字”选项卡中选择“数字”类别。

  4. 将小数位数设置为2。

结果将显示为123.46。

2. 使用快捷键

可以使用快捷键快速设置小数位数。

例子:

选择A1单元格,按下Ctrl+1打开“设置单元格格式”对话框,然后按照上面的步骤设置小数位数。

三、四舍五入保留尾数

除了使用ROUND函数进行四舍五入外,还可以通过其他方法实现。

1. 使用ROUNDUP和ROUNDDOWN函数

ROUNDUP函数用于向上舍入,ROUNDDOWN函数用于向下舍入。

例子:

假设在A1单元格中有一个数字123.4567,你希望向上舍入到两位小数,可以在B1单元格中输入以下公式:

  
=ROUNDUP(A1, 2)
  

结果将是123.46。

如果你希望向下舍入到两位小数,可以在B1单元格中输入以下公式:

  
=ROUNDDOWN(A1, 2)
  

结果将是123.45。

2. 使用INT函数

INT函数用于返回小于或等于指定数字的最大整数。

例子:

假设在A1单元格中有一个数字123.4567,你希望保留整数部分,可以在B1单元格中输入以下公式:

  
=INT(A1)
  

结果将是123。

四、使用自定义函数保留尾数

在某些情况下,内置函数可能无法满足特定的需求,可以通过编写VBA(Visual Basic for Applications)自定义函数来实现。

1. 编写VBA自定义函数

打开Excel,按下Alt+F11进入VBA编辑器,插入一个新的模块,然后编写以下代码:

  
Function CustomRound(Number As Double, DecimalPlaces As Integer) As Double
  
    CustomRound = WorksheetFunction.Round(Number, DecimalPlaces)  
End Function  

保存并关闭VBA编辑器。

2. 使用自定义函数

回到Excel,在单元格中输入以下公式:

  
=CustomRound(A1, 2)
  

结果将是123.46。

五、在数据分析中的应用

保留尾数在数据分析中有广泛的应用,例如财务报表、统计数据和科学计算中。

1. 财务报表

在财务报表中,保留尾数可以确保报告的准确性和一致性。

例子:

假设你在制作一份财务报表,需要将所有金额保留两位小数,可以使用ROUND函数或格式设置来确保所有金额一致。

2. 统计数据

在统计数据分析中,保留尾数可以提高结果的准确性。

例子:

假设你在进行一项调查,需要计算平均值和标准差,可以使用ROUND函数保留合适的小数位数以确保结果准确。

3. 科学计算

在科学计算中,保留尾数可以提高计算结果的精度。

例子:

假设你在进行一项实验,需要记录测量结果并进行计算,可以使用TRUNC或MOD函数保留适当的尾数以确保结果精确。

六、常见问题及解决方法

在使用Excel保留尾数的过程中,可能会遇到一些常见问题,以下是几种常见问题及其解决方法。

1. 数字显示为科学计数法

当数字较大或较小时,Excel可能会自动将其显示为科学计数法。可以通过设置单元格格式来解决。

解决方法:

右键点击需要设置的单元格,选择“设置单元格格式”,在“数字”选项卡中选择“数字”类别,然后设置小数位数。

2. 保留尾数后出现不准确问题

在某些情况下,保留尾数后可能会出现不准确的问题,例如四舍五入误差。可以通过增加小数位数或使用不同的函数来解决。

解决方法:

使用更精确的函数,例如使用ROUND、ROUNDUP或ROUNDDOWN函数。

3. 函数结果不更新

当使用函数保留尾数时,可能会遇到结果不更新的问题。可以通过重新计算或刷新数据来解决。

解决方法:

按下F9键重新计算所有公式,或使用Ctrl+Alt+F9强制重新计算所有数据。

七、提高Excel操作技巧的建议

为了更好地使用Excel保留尾数功能,可以学习和掌握一些高级技巧和方法。

1. 学习和使用快捷键

掌握Excel快捷键可以大大提高工作效率。

例子:

使用Ctrl+1快速打开“设置单元格格式”对话框,使用F9重新计算所有公式。

2. 参加Excel培训课程

参加Excel培训课程可以系统地学习Excel的各种功能和技巧。

例子:

参加Excel高级培训课程,学习如何使用VBA编写自定义函数和宏,提高数据处理能力。

3. 阅读Excel专业书籍

阅读Excel专业书籍可以深入了解Excel的各种功能和应用。

例子:

阅读《Excel 2019 Bible》或《Excel Data Analysis For Dummies》,学习如何在实际工作中应用Excel功能。

八、总结

保留尾数是Excel数据处理中的重要功能,通过使用函数、格式设置和自定义函数,可以灵活地保留数字的尾数。在实际应用中,选择合适的方法和工具可以提高数据处理的精度和效率。同时,通过学习和掌握Excel的高级技巧,可以进一步提升工作效率和数据分析能力。无论是在财务报表、统计数据还是科学计算中,保留尾数都起着至关重要的作用。希望本文提供的详细介绍和实用方法能帮助你更好地掌握Excel保留尾数的技巧。

相关问答FAQs:

1. 在Excel中如何保留数字的尾数?

  • 问题:如何在Excel中保留数字的尾数?

  • 回答:在Excel中,您可以使用以下方法来保留数字的尾数:

  • 使用格式化功能:选择您想要保留尾数的单元格,然后点击“格式化”选项。在“数字”选项卡中,选择“常规”或“数字”格式,并设置所需的小数位数。

  • 使用ROUND函数:在另一个单元格中,使用ROUND函数来将数字四舍五入到所需的小数位数。例如,使用“=ROUND(A1, 2)”将A1单元格中的数字四舍五入到2位小数。

  • 使用自定义格式:在格式化选项中,选择“自定义”选项卡,并使用自定义格式来指定所需的小数位数。例如,使用“0.00”格式将数字保留到2位小数。

2. 如何在Excel中截断数字的尾数?

  • 问题:如何在Excel中截断数字的尾数而不进行四舍五入?

  • 回答:若要在Excel中截断数字的尾数而不进行四舍五入,您可以尝试以下方法:

  • 使用TRUNC函数:在另一个单元格中,使用TRUNC函数来截断数字的尾数。例如,使用“=TRUNC(A1, 2)”将A1单元格中的数字截断到2位小数。

  • 使用格式化功能:选择您想要截断尾数的单元格,然后点击“格式化”选项。在“数字”选项卡中,选择“常规”或“数字”格式,并设置所需的小数位数为0。

3. 如何在Excel中保留数字的特定尾数?

  • 问题:如何在Excel中保留数字的特定尾数,例如只保留小数点后两位?

  • 回答:若要在Excel中保留数字的特定尾数,您可以使用以下方法:

  • 使用ROUND函数:在另一个单元格中,使用ROUND函数来将数字四舍五入到所需的小数位数。例如,使用“=ROUND(A1, 2)”将A1单元格中的数字四舍五入到2位小数。

  • 使用格式化功能:选择您想要保留尾数的单元格,然后点击“格式化”选项。在“数字”选项卡中,选择“常规”或“数字”格式,并设置所需的小数位数为2。

  • 使用自定义格式:在格式化选项中,选择“自定义”选项卡,并使用自定义格式来指定所需的小数位数。例如,使用“0.00”格式将数字保留到2位小数。

© 2023 北京元石科技有限公司 ◎ 京公网安备 11010802042949号